Overview

Parsons is looking for an amazingly talented Health & Safety Coordinator (Saudi National) to join our team!

Responsibilities
  • Health & Safety Program Support: Assist in the development, implementation, and maintenance of health and safety policies, procedures, and training programs. Ensure all safety programs are compliant with local, state, and federal safety regulations. Help to monitor safety performance and recommend improvements to enhance safety protocols.

  • Risk Assessment and Hazard Identification: Conduct regular risk assessments and safety audits to identify potential hazards in the workplace. Help develop and implement corrective actions to mitigate risks and prevent accidents. Provide guidance on safe work practices and control measures to eliminate hazards.

  • Health & Safety Training and Education: Assist with organizing and delivering health and safety training sessions for employees, contractors, and visitors. Ensure all employees are aware of safety protocols, emergency response procedures, and the correct use of personal protective equipment (PPE). Maintain records of all safety training sessions and employee certifications.

  • Incident Reporting and Investigation: Assist in investigating workplace accidents, injuries, and near-misses to determine root causes. Prepare and submit incident reports to management and regulatory agencies as required. Help develop corrective actions to prevent future occurrences of similar incidents.

  • Regulatory Compliance and Documentation: Ensure workplace safety practices comply with all relevant safety regulations (e.g., OSHA standards). Assist in preparing safety reports and maintaining records for regulatory compliance. Coordinate with management to ensure timely reporting of safety-related issues to regulatory bodies.

  • Emergency Preparedness and Response: Assist in the development and maintenance of emergency response plans for various scenarios (e.g., fire, medical emergencies, chemical spills). Help organize and participate in emergency drills to ensure employees are prepared for emergency situations. Ensure all emergency equipment is in good working order and accessible.

  • Safety Monitoring and Reporting: Help monitor safety performance and track key safety metrics (e.g., accident rates, safety violations). Report on health and safety performance regularly to management, highlighting any concerns or areas for improvement. Work closely with other departments to ensure safety goals and initiatives are being met.

  • Health & Safety Materials and Equipment: Ensure that safety materials, including safety signs, first aid kits, and PPE, are available and in good condition. Manage the inventory of safety equipment and make recommendations for additional resources when needed.

Job Description:

Parsons is looking for an amazingly talented Senior Health & Safety Coordinator (Saudi National) to join our team! In this role you will get to play a vital role in safeguarding personnel, minimizing risks, and ensuring regulatory compliance on complex infrastructure projects. With 5 years of hands-on experience, the right candidate will be passionate about health and safety, capable of managing on-site HSE activities, and committed to driving excellence in construction safety performance. This position offers an opportunity to contribute to the success of a landmark project while promoting a safe working environment for all involved.

What You’ll Be Doing:

1. Safety Program Implementation:

  • Assist in the development, implementation, and maintenance of site-specific health and safety plans, procedures, and policies.

  • Ensure project compliance with local and international safety standards, laws, and regulations.

  • Monitor site activities to confirm safe work practices and enforce compliance with HSE requirements.

2. Inspections, Audits & Risk Assessments:

  • Conduct regular site safety inspections and audits to identify unsafe conditions, practices, and potential hazards.

  • Lead and document risk assessments, job hazard analyses (JHAs), and method statement reviews.

  • Ensure prompt corrective and preventive actions are taken and recorded to address safety issues.

3. Incident Investigation & Reporting:

  • Support or lead investigations of incidents, near misses, and unsafe conditions to identify root causes and develop action plans.

  • Maintain accurate and timely records of all safety incidents, inspections, and audit findings.

  • Ensure incident reporting aligns with company and client protocols.

4. Training and Awareness:

  • Organize and conduct safety inductions, toolbox talks, and refresher training for project staff and subcontractors.

  • Promote awareness of HSE procedures and create a safety-conscious culture across all site personnel.

  • Support emergency preparedness initiatives including drills and evacuation plans.

5. Stakeholder Coordination:

  • Liaise with construction managers, subcontractors, consultants, and client representatives to align safety objectives.

  • Ensure safety requirements are integrated into planning and execution of construction activities.

  • Participate in HSE coordination meetings and contribute to project safety planning.

6. Documentation and Compliance Monitoring:

  • Maintain up-to-date records of inspections, safety meetings, permits, and training logs.

  • Support compliance with ISO 45001 and other relevant HSE management systems.

  • Ensure all permits to work (PTWs) and safety documentation are in place and adhered to on site.
